Shield AI has announced its inclusion in the first set of projects selected to receive funding for the US Office of the Under Secretary of Defense for Research and Engineering (OUSD R&E)’s pilot program to Accelerate the Procurement and Fielding of Innovative Technologies (APFIT).

Shield AI’s APFIT project involves the initial procurement of V-BAT Unmanned Aerial Systems (UAS) — semi-autonomous, long-loiter, Vertical Take Off and Landing (VTOL) UAS with modular payload capability — that can provide resilient data transport and locate and provide weapon quality targeting information as part of the Joint Sensing Grid to Joint All Domain Command and Control (JADC2).  

According to the Department of Defense (DoD), the purpose of the APFIT pilot program is to expeditiously transition technologies and get them in the warfighters’ hands. The benefits of this pilot will be to deliver war-winning capabilities to the warfighter.

With a near-zero footprint VTOL and long-endurance capabilities, the V-BAT is propelled by a single, ducted, thrust-vectored fan and can take off and land in the style of a SpaceX rocket. Its fully operational logistical footprint fits into the bed of a pickup truck or inside a Blackhawk helicopter, significantly reducing the total cost of capability. 

US and international customers view the V-BAT as a flexible, cost-efficient platform capable of performing Group 2 UAS to Group 5 UAS missions and beyond.  

Shield AI’s Hivemind software is an Artificial Intelligence (AI) pilot for military and commercial aircraft that enables intelligent teams of aircraft to perform missions ranging from room clearance, to penetrating air defense systems, and dogfighting F-16s. 

Hivemind employs state-of-the-art algorithms for planning, mapping, and state-estimation to enable aircraft to execute dynamic flight maneuvers and uses reinforcement learning for discovery, learning, and execution of winning tactics and strategies. On aircraft, Hivemind enables full autonomy and is designed to run fully on the edge, disconnected from the cloud, in high threat, GPS and communication-degraded environments.
